1. Secure and Reliable

Security is paramount in ecommerce. Customers trust you with their sensitive information, such as credit card details and personal data. Shopify excels in this area by offering PCI compliance, free SSL certificates, secure hosting, and robust payment processing. The platform performs security updates automatically, ensuring that your site remains secure without additional effort on your part.

In contrast, WooCommerce requires manual installation of SSL certificates and has had several reported vulnerabilities. Managing security patches and updates can become cumbersome, especially if you lack technical expertise. With Shopify, you can focus on growing your business while the platform handles encryption, data backups, and network security seamlessly.

2. Improved Total Cost of Ownership (TCO)

While WooCommerce might seem cost-effective initially due to its free base, the hidden costs quickly add up. You'll need additional plugins for essential features, security measures, and hosting fees, leading to higher cumulative expenses. On the other hand, Shopify offers a transparent pricing model with an all-in-one ecommerce solution.

Data highlights that Shopify’s total cost of ownership is 36% lower than WooCommerce. With predefined pricing, you can access everything necessary for a fully functional and secure online store. This predictability and the reduction in reliance on developers make Shopify a more economical choice for businesses of all sizes.

3. Usable and Agile

Shopify is renowned for its user-friendly interface and ease of use, making it accessible even for those without technical expertise. The platform’s intuitive design and low-code environment simplify store management, enabling quick updates and adjustments. This usability allows businesses to respond swiftly to market trends and demands.

On the flip side, WooCommerce operates as a WordPress plugin, often necessitating developer assistance for updates and changes. This reliance on technical skills can hinder agility and increase costs. Shopify’s “clicks not code” approach streamlines operations, reducing the learning curve and allowing businesses to save on development expenses.

6. More Capabilities & Out-of-the-Box Excellence

Shopify provides a comprehensive ecommerce solution with extensive built-in features and a reliable app ecosystem. From semantic search to multi-currency management and advanced B2B functionalities, Shopify offers tools that cater to diverse business needs.

The platform's extensive app ecosystem, featuring over 8,000 trusted apps, allows easy extension of functionality without complex integrations. This contrasts with WooCommerce, where reliance on multiple plugins can lead to compatibility issues and increased maintenance. Shopify’s seamless integration capabilities and consistent updates ensure that your business always has access to modern commerce innovations.
